Is one of Apple’s rumored new mixed reality (XR) headsets finally coming?
It is rumored that Apple’s first head-mounted display device will begin mass production at the end of the first quarter of 2023, and Pegatron has won the exclusive contract for the final assembly this time.
According to rumors, this head-mounted display product, which is code-named N301 internally by Apple, is equipped with an ultra-high-resolution 8K display and has eye-tracking technology. Just one helmet product uses 15 lenses for Accurate eye capture, motion tracking, and more.
Apple requires suppliers to assemble and manufacture this XR product in a semiconductor clean room grade.
